Question

An equation is shown.
y=-5h^2+gh-16
What is the equation, solved for g?

To solve the equation \( y = -5h^2 + gh - 16 \) for \( g \), we need to isolate \( g \) on one side of the equation. Here are the steps:

1. Start with the equation:
\[
y = -5h^2 + gh - 16
\]

2. Add \( 5h^2 \) and \( 16 \) to both sides:
\[
y + 5h^2 + 16 = gh
\]

3. To isolate \( g \), divide both sides by \( h \) (assuming \( h \neq 0 \)):
\[
g = \frac{y + 5h^2 + 16}{h}
\]

Thus, the equation solved for \( g \) is:
\[
g = \frac{y + 5h^2 + 16}{h}
\]
